From Centimeters to Inches: A Comprehensive Guide to Unit Conversion



Unit conversion is a fundamental skill in numerous fields, from engineering and construction to cooking and everyday life. The conversion between centimeters (cm) and inches (in) is particularly common, as it bridges the gap between the metric and imperial systems. This article will address the conversion of 40 centimeters to inches, exploring common challenges and providing a clear, step-by-step solution. Understanding this simple conversion forms a foundation for tackling more complex unit conversion problems.

Understanding the Conversion Factor



The key to converting between centimeters and inches lies in understanding the conversion factor. One inch is equal to approximately 2.54 centimeters. This means that there are 2.54 centimeters in every inch. This ratio is crucial for all conversions between these two units. We can express this relationship in two ways:

1 in = 2.54 cm
1 cm ≈ 0.3937 in

The approximate value for centimeters to inches (0.3937) is derived from the reciprocal of 2.54 (1/2.54 ≈ 0.3937). Using either form of the conversion factor will lead to the correct answer, though minor discrepancies may arise due to rounding.

Method 1: Direct Conversion using the Conversion Factor



The most straightforward method involves directly applying the conversion factor. Since we know 1 inch equals 2.54 cm, we can set up a proportion to solve for the equivalent inches in 40 cm:

1 in / 2.54 cm = x in / 40 cm

To solve for 'x', we cross-multiply:

2.54 cm x in = 1 in 40 cm

Now, isolate 'x' by dividing both sides by 2.54 cm:

x in = (1 in 40 cm) / 2.54 cm

x in ≈ 15.75 in

Therefore, 40 centimeters is approximately equal to 15.75 inches.


Method 2: Using the Reciprocal Conversion Factor



Alternatively, we can use the reciprocal conversion factor (1 cm ≈ 0.3937 in):

40 cm 0.3937 in/cm = x in

x in ≈ 15.75 in

This method simplifies the calculation, especially when dealing with larger numbers. The result remains consistent with the previous method.

Addressing Common Challenges and Errors



One common error is incorrectly applying the conversion factor. Remember to always ensure the units cancel out correctly. For instance, multiplying 40 cm by 2.54 cm/in would result in an incorrect answer with units of cm²/in, rather than inches.

Another challenge arises from rounding. The conversion factor (2.54) is precise, but using rounded values (e.g., 0.39 instead of 0.3937) can lead to slight inaccuracies in the final result, especially for larger values. It's generally best to use the full conversion factor whenever possible, and then round the final answer to an appropriate number of significant figures.

Dealing with More Complex Scenarios



The principles described above can be extended to more complex scenarios. For example, if you need to convert a measurement that includes both centimeters and inches, you must first convert one unit to the other before performing any addition or subtraction. Similarly, when converting areas or volumes, the conversion factor needs to be squared or cubed respectively.

FAQs:



1. What is the exact value of 40 cm in inches? The exact value is 40/2.54 inches, which is approximately 15.748 inches. Rounding depends on the required precision.

2. Can I use online converters for cm to inch conversions? Yes, many online converters are readily available, providing a quick and convenient method for conversions. However, it is beneficial to understand the underlying principles to avoid relying solely on these tools.

3. How do I convert square centimeters to square inches? You need to square the conversion factor. The conversion factor is (1 in/2.54 cm)² = 0.155 in²/cm². So, multiply the area in square centimeters by 0.155 to get the area in square inches.

4. How do I convert cubic centimeters to cubic inches? You need to cube the conversion factor. The conversion factor is (1 in/2.54 cm)³ ≈ 0.061 in³/cm³. So, multiply the volume in cubic centimeters by 0.061 to get the volume in cubic inches.

5. What if I need to convert inches to centimeters? Simply use the inverse of the conversion factor. Multiply the value in inches by 2.54 to get the equivalent value in centimeters.
